如何在asp.net项目中实现一个md5加密功能

介绍

本篇文章给大家分享的是有关如何在asp.net项目中实现一个md5加密功能,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。

代码如下:


///& lt; summary>
,///md5加密
,///& lt;/summary>
,///& lt;参数name=皊trSource"在需要加密的明文& lt;/param>
,///& lt; returns>返回32位加密结果& lt;/returns>
,公共静态字符串Get_MD5(你要的字符串,字符串sEncode)
, {
,,,,//新
,,,,System.Security.Cryptography。MD5 MD5=new System.Security.Cryptography.MD5CryptoServiceProvider ();

,,,,//获取密文字节数组
,,,,byte [] bytResult=md5.ComputeHash (System.Text.Encoding.GetEncoding (sEncode) .GetBytes(你要));

,,,,//转换成字符串,并取9到25位
,,,,//字符串strResult=BitConverter。ToString (bytResult、4、8),,
,,,,//转换成字符串,32位

,,,,字符串strResult=BitConverter.ToString (bytResult);

,,,,//BitConverter转换出来的字符串会在每个字符中间产生一个分隔符,需要去除掉
,,,,strResult=strResult.Replace(“产生绯闻,““);

,,,,返回strResult.ToLower ();
,}

如何在asp.net项目中实现一个md5加密功能